the chemical equation, h₂o --> h₂ + o₂ is __. we can add coefficients to this chemical equation by adding a in front of h₂o, in front of h₂ and __ in front of o₂. unbalanced; 2; 2; 1 balanced; 2; 2; 1 balanced; 4; 2; 1

Explanation:

Step1: Check balance of original equation

In $H_2O
ightarrow H_2 + O_2$, left - hand side has 1 oxygen atom and right - hand side has 2 oxygen atoms, 2 hydrogen atoms on both sides initially. So it is unbalanced.

Step2: Balance the equation

To balance oxygen, put 2 in front of $H_2O$: $2H_2O
ightarrow H_2+O_2$. Now there are 4 hydrogen atoms on left - hand side. So put 2 in front of $H_2$ to get $2H_2O
ightarrow 2H_2 + O_2$.

Answer:

A. unbalanced; 2; 2; 1
